Gaeng Bawt Pork, Chicken, Duck or Tofu A typical Yuan Kalom stew from our home village. This stew is has a potpourri of vegetables flavored with roasted rice, pepper wood, banana flower, lemon grass, fennel, shallots, basil. If you see pieces of wood in your stew this is called Mai Sakhan or pepper wood. You can eat it. Be careful it can be spicy.
Aw Lahm Pork, Chicken, Duck or Tofu A typical Luang Prabang stew. The ingredients are more finely cut than Gaeng Bawt. Some ingredients are seasonal but the main ones are egg plant, chili pepper, rattan shoots, banana flower, pumpkin shoots, lemon grass, fennel, shallots, basil. SOOP Pork, Duck, Chicken, Tofu "SOOP" is a fresh, tangy soupy stew flavored with cilantro (coriander), mint and Lao limes
Black Thai Stew Chicken, Pork, Duck or Tofu Soaked roasted rice, pepper wood, rattan shoots, garlic, mushrooms, basil, mak ken, a tingly forest spice.
